For example, if you earn under $100,000 annually, up to $25,000 of rental income losses qualify as deductible, and can save thousands of dollars on other income origins through this tax deduction. However, if you earn over $100,000 a year, this deduction begins to phase out, until is actually also completely gone for taxpayers earning $150,000 and above annually.
